Summary: A ravishing young mind reader stalks the streets at night in kitten heels, prowling for men to murder. A soft-spoken genius toils away in the city morgue, desperate to unearth the science behind his gift for shapeshifting. It's a match made in 1928 Chicago, where gangsters run City Hall, jazz fills the air, and every good girl's purse conceals a flask. Until now, eighteen-year-old Ruby's penchant for poison has been a secret. No one knows that she uses her mind-reading abilities to target men who prey on vulnerable women, men who escape the clutches of Chicago justice. When she meets a brilliant boy working at the morgue, his knack for forensic detail threatens to uncover her dark hobby. Even more unfortunately -- sharp, independent Ruby has fallen in love with him. Waltzing between a supernaturally enhanced romance, the battle to take down a gentleman's club, and loyal friendships worth their weight in diamonds, Ruby brings defiant charm to every spectacular page -- not to mention killer fashion.
